Accurate spectroscopic data of carbon dioxide are widely used in many important applications, such as carbon monitoring missions. Here, we present comb-locked cavity ring-down saturation spectroscopy of the second most abundant isotopologue of CO2, 13C16O2. We determined the positions of 88 lines in three vibrational bands in the 1.6 µm region, 30011e/30012e/30013e-00001e, with an accuracy of a few kHz. Based on the analysis of combination differences, we obtained for the first time the ground-state rotational energies with kHz accuracy. We also provide a set of hybrid line positions for 150 13C16O2 transitions. The rotational energies (J < 50) in the 30013e vibrational state can be fitted by a set of rotational and centrifugal constants with deviations within a few kHz, indicating that the 30013e state is free of perturbations. These precise isotopic line positions will be utilized to improve the Hamiltonian model and quantitative remote sensing of carbon dioxide. Moreover, they will help to track changes in the carbon source and sink through isotopic analysis.

Objective: To evaluate the clinical efficacy and immune function of Daratumumab combined with chemotherapy in patients with relapsed/refractory multiple myeloma (RRMM). Methods: Eighty patients with RRMM treated in Xingtai People's Hospital from January, 2020 to December, 2021 were randomly divided into two groups. Patients in the study group were treated with Daratumumab combined with PAD regimen, while patients in the control group were provided with PAD regimen alone. Further comparison was performed on the therapeutic effects, adverse drug reactions, the levels of T lymphocyte subsets CD3+, CD4+, CD8+ and CD4+/CD8+, the positive expression rate of CD38 and the expression level of Notch-1 on the membrane of plasma cells between the two groups. Results: The overall response rate in the study group (67.50%) was significantly better than that in the control group (45.00%). There was no significant difference in the incidence of adverse reactions between the two groups. After treatment, the reviewed levels of CD3+, CD4+ and CD4+/CD8+ were obviously higher in the study group than those in the control group, while the positive expression rate of CD38 and the expression level of Notch one on the membrane of plasma cells were both lower than those in the control group (p<0.05). Conclusion: Daratumumab combined with a PAD regimen is a safe and effective approach that has a definite curative effect on patients with RRMM, which can improve immune function significantly and result in no significant increase in adverse reactions.

Objective: To study the effect of dexmedetomidine on cognitive function in rats with cognitive impairment after partial hepatectomy and its mechanism. Methods: 60 SD rats were randomly divided into 4 groups (n = 15): blank control group (CG group), sham operation group (Sham group), cognitive impairment model group (POCD group), and dexmedetomidine + cognitive impairment model group (DEX group). Rats in the POCD group underwent left lobe hepatectomy and intraperitoneal injection of the same amount of normal saline after resuscitation. Rats in the DEX group underwent left lobe hepatectomy and intraperitoneal injection of dexmedetomidine 50 µg/kg. Group CG was not operated on and the same amount of normal saline was injected intraperitoneally. In the Sham group, liver resection was not allowed after the abdominal incision, and normal saline was injected intraperitoneally. Rats were injected every 24 hours for 5 consecutive days. Morris water maze (MWM) were used to evaluate the effects of dexmedetomidine on learning and memory ability of POCD rats. TUNEL method was used to detect apoptotic neurons in the hippocampus. INOS, Arg-1, IL-6, and TNF-αexpression levels were detected. Western blot detects the expression level of TNF-α, Bcl-2, and NF-κB protein. Result: Compared with the CG group, the escape latency of the other three groups was prolonged on the 5th day after the operation, and the number of crossing the platform was reduced. Compared with the Sham group, the escape latency of the POCD group and DEX group was significantly prolonged, and the number of crossing the platform was significantly reduced on day 5 (P < 0.05). Compared with the POCD group, the DEX group shortened the escape latency and increased the number of crossing the platform on the 5th day (P < 0.05). It shows that the spatial learning and memory function of rats has been restored to a certain extent.The number of iNOS and Arg-1 positive cells in the POCD group and DEX group was higher than that in the control group, and the number of Arg-1 positive cells in the DEX group was higher than that in the POCD group (P < 0.05). Western blot results the expression of Bcl-2 and NF-κB protein in POCD group, and DEX group was higher than that of the sham group (P < 0.05). The expression of Bcl-2 and NF-κB protein was the most in POCD group. The expression of Bcl-2 and NF-κB protein in DEX group was lower than that in POCD group (P < 0.05). Conclusion: Behavioral results showed that the learning and cognitive ability of POCD model rats after hepatectomy was impaired, and inflammatory factors and activated microglia were found in the hippocampus of POCD rats. Dexmedetomidine may improve the brain function of POCD rats by inhibiting neuronal apoptosis,partly through NF-κB apoptosis pathway.

Objective: To investigate the effects of dexmedetomidine intervention on serum inflammatory factor concentration and postoperative cognitive malfunction in elderly patients with general anesthesia. Methodology. 174 patients with general anesthesia were selected, who were categorized into a control group (HC) and a dexmedetomidine group (HS) using the random number table method, with 87 patients in individual groups. The dexmedetomidine group was pumped intravenously with dexmedetomidine at a loading dose of 1 µg/kg before induction of anesthesia for 15 min, followed by continuous intravenous pumping at a rate of 0.4 µg/kg/h, and the dosing was stopped at 30 min before concluding the surgery. The control group was administered the identical dose of saline in the same manner. Interleukin 6 (IL-6) and tumor necrosis factor α (TNF-α) levels and MMES scores were tested at 1 h before and 24 h after anesthesia. Results: Comparing to HC group, patients in the HS group had lower TNF-α and IL-6 levels at both scheduled points (P < 0.05). Conclusion: Dexmedetomidine reduced the expression of inflammatory factors in elderly patients with general anesthesia and effectively reduced the incidence of postoperative cognitive dysfunction after general anesthesia surgery.
